All lakes in the tri-county area are still closed. Barton Springs Pool is closed today, but will be open tomorrow for the first time in almost a week. The Hike and Bike Trail is closed due to flooding. Most public pools are operating as usual, but who likes chlorine anyway? Your best best for a few hours of sun: Deep Eddy Pool is open all day.
